KŠB Succeeds in Chambers & Partners Ranking Once Again

In the recently published Chambers Europe 2023, KŠB and its lawyers are recommended in nine areas. The yearbook is the result of an analysis of a number of criteria, with the greatest weight given to the experience and opinions of clients themselves.

We would therefore like to thank our clients in particular for their positive feedback on our work, which has led us to be ranked in the following categories:

  • Banking
  • Capital Markets
  • Competition
  • Compliance
  • Corporate/M&A
  • Dispute Resolution
  • Employment
  • Projects&Energy
  • Tax
